Connect Aiven with a personal API token to sync organization users, projects and services, and run access reviews. Read-only.
Read-only access. DSALTA only reads data from this integration. It never creates, modifies, or deletes anything in your environment, and every remediation step is performed by your team directly in the third-party product.
What you’ll see. The Access page lists the human users of one Aiven organization — the one with the lowest organization ID among those the token can see — with their name, email, whether they are a Super Admin or a Member, whether they are managed by SCIM, the date they joined, and Aiven’s own active or inactive state. Application users (Aiven’s machine accounts) are left out. Aiven reports no MFA state on this endpoint, so the MFA column shows Unknown.
DSALTA collects this integration’s data when you connect it — you can refresh it at any time with Sync from integrations on the Integrations page. The compliance checks below re-run once a day at 02:00 America/New_York.
What DSALTA reads
DSALTA reads the Aiven organization user roster — names, emails, super-admin status, SCIM management, join dates and account state — which appears on your Access page; and your Aiven projects and the services inside them, which appear on your Inventory page with their cloud, tier, service type, plan and state.It calls these Aiven endpoints:/v1/me/v1/organizations/v1/organization/{id}/user/v1/project/v1/project/{name}/service
Troubleshooting
The Access page is missing users, or shows the wrong organization
The Access page is missing users, or shows the wrong organization
A personal token inherits the permissions of the user who created it, and among the organizations that token can see, DSALTA syncs the one with the lowest organization ID. Create the token as an organization admin who belongs to the organization you want reviewed. If your admin belongs to several organizations, create the token from a user who belongs only to the one you want.

The token stopped working
Aiven tokens carry a session duration chosen at creation, and an organization can enforce an authentication policy that limits personal tokens. Generate a new token, then disconnect and connect again. Note that disconnecting permanently deletes the data already collected from Aiven.

How do I check whether the connection is healthy?
Open Integrations in the DSALTA sidebar, stay on the Connected tab, and click Manage on the integration’s card. Open the Status tab: it shows either Connected and working properly or Connection issues detected.Use the Status tab, not Overview — Overview always reports Connected regardless of the real state.

A check shows Failed and nothing changed on my side
On an integration-powered check, Failed normally means DSALTA was blocked rather than that you are non-compliant. Open the test, go to Source Data, and read the result code: 403 is a missing permission, 428 is a setting DSALTA still needs, 500 is a failure on DSALTA’s side.A real compliance gap shows 207 and leaves the test looking Completed. Data looks out of date
Compliance checks re-run once a day at 02:00 America/New_York. To refresh sooner, open Integrations → Connected and click Sync from integrations at the top right — it refreshes every connected integration at once.

How do I repair a broken connection?
There is no Reconnect, Repair or Refresh Token button. The only repair available is to disconnect and connect again.

Configure scope will not let me change anything
That is expected. Configure scope is read-only — it shows what DSALTA is permitted to read, and has no Save action. To change what DSALTA can see, change the permissions on the credential in the third-party product, then disconnect and connect again.
